| Welcome to the Quiet Room |
| クワイエットルームにようこそ |
| |
 |
| © 2007 “Welcome to the Quiet Room” Film Partners |
|
Asuka awakes to find herself in the isolated ward of a psychiatric hospital for women. The young magazine journalist has been in a coma for two days after an abusive night of alcohol and sedatives, and no recollection of what happened. In ‘the quiet room’, Asuka is forced to deal with her repressed past, amidst a quirky assortment of fellow patients. |
